Tight Tolerance Machining: Precision That Defines Performance
What is Tight Tolerance Machining?
Tight tolerance machining is the process of producing components with extremely strict dimensional requirements, often within ±0.001 inches or even finer. In industries where the smallest error can compromise performance, this capability ensures that parts fit and function exactly as intended. It combines advanced CNC technology, precise tooling, and rigorous quality controls to deliver flawless components across a range of materials.
Key Elements of Tight Tolerance Machining
1.Advanced Equipment and Tooling
High-end CNC machines, specialized fixtures, and calibrated tools form the backbone of tight tolerance machining. These systems eliminate vibration, reduce tool wear, and enable repeatable accuracy.
2.Material Expertise
Understanding how metals, alloys, and plastics behave under different machining conditions is crucial. From thermal expansion to stress management, skilled machinists optimize parameters like speed, feed, and cooling to achieve stable results.
3.Quality Control and Inspection
Precision doesn’t stop at cutting. Each ...
... part is inspected with high-resolution measurement tools, such as coordinate measuring machines (CMMs), to ensure compliance with design specifications. Continuous in-process checks reduce errors and eliminate costly rework.
Why Tight Tolerance Matters
•Flawless Assembly – Components fit seamlessly, reducing assembly time and preventing failure.
•Reliability – Precision ensures that parts perform consistently under demanding conditions.
•Waste Reduction – Enhanced process control minimizes scrap and saves costs.
•Scalability – Suitable for both prototypes and full-scale production, maintaining accuracy throughout.
Industries That Benefit Most
Sectors such as aerospace, defense, automotive, medical devices, and electronics demand tight tolerance machining. Whether it’s surgical instruments, turbine components, or micro-electronics housings, precision manufacturing directly impacts safety, reliability, and performance.
Selecting the Right Partner
Not all machining companies specialize in ultra-precision work. The right partner will have proven experience across materials, in-house tooling capabilities, and comprehensive inspection systems. Early consultation during the design phase also helps optimize manufacturability and reduce downstream issues.
